1150 Lincoln Ave Ste 1
Holbrook, NY 11741
631-563-3701MAP DIRECTIONS
1150 Lincoln Ave Ste 2
Holbrook, NY 11741
631-563-2100MAP DIRECTIONS
1150 Lincoln Ave Ste 1
Holbrook, NY 11741
631-589-2000MAP DIRECTIONS
1170 Lincoln Ave Unit 5
Holbrook, NY 11741
631-218-1334MAP DIRECTIONS